# Service Accounts — Template Rendering

The Quillfast rendering cluster uses a dedicated service account, `render-perf-bot`, to fetch compiled templates and push timing metrics to the Lanternworks dashboard. New team members should never reuse personal credentials for load tests; always go through the service account so cache-warm numbers stay comparable. Rotation happens monthly via the Hearthpipe scheduler, and the previous key is revoked 24 hours after rollover. The current key for the rendering metrics endpoint is shown below.

service key, yadug-bajog: zpat3_pou

## Ownership

Graphgnome, our dependency graph visualizer, lives in this repo. If you're reviewing changes to the layout engine or the cycle detector, loop in the owner early — those bits are touchy. Everything else is fair game for normal review. The current owner is named below.

account owner for bawip-tahag: Raleth Quenok

# Break-Glass: Catalog Cache Invalidation

Scope: the Pinrow product catalog at Veldstone Retail. If stale prices persist after a purge and the Hollowmere invalidation queue is wedged, use break-glass to flush the edge tier directly. Contractors: get verbal sign-off from the catalog lead first. Steps: open the Hollowmere admin shell, select emergency-flush, confirm the tenant, and run it once — repeated flushes thrash the origin. Access is logged and expires after 20 minutes. Unseal the admin shell with the passphrase below.

recovery phrase for kahop-tajog: istix-casvan

Finance Review Summary — Customer Concentration, Verelux Group

Revenue concentration remains elevated: the Dunmoor account represents 31% of recurring income, up from 26% last year. Two further accounts together add 18%. Contract renewal timing clusters in the second quarter, compounding exposure. Heads of department should factor this into hiring and inventory commitments. Mitigation options are under review, and the confidential note below sets out the plan.

internal memo for faweg-hahip: Silokix Works plans to lower the Tamvan list price by 8 percent in June.